An Orange County judge scolded six years ago for her unorthodox style in the courtroom returned to the hot seat again this week.
Superior Court Judge Susanne S. Shaw repeatedly interjected herself into a man's assault trial, prompting the 4th District Court of Appeal to toss out the conviction and order a new trial with a new judge.
